You might just scan your regexes for /\\[a-z]/, but I really don't think in practice you will find anything that actually needs conversion.

Update: Reading more closely, I see a few areas of minor concern for character classes; perl doesn't support collating symbols (e.g. [[.fu.]]) or equivalence class expressions (e.g. [[=à=]]), and perl treats backslash in a character class as an escaping character but egrep should treat it as a literal backslash.
